The Ecological Influence of E-Waste
The incorrect disposal of electronic waste, commonly called e-waste, has considerable environmental effects. E-waste refers to disposed of electronic tools such as smartphones, televisions, and computer systems (computer recycling). These devices contain hazardous products such as lead, mercury, cadmium, and brominated flame resistants, which can be dangerous to both human health and wellness and the environment otherwise properly taken care of
When e-waste is poorly taken care of, it typically winds up in land fills or is incinerated, releasing poisonous compounds right into the water, air, and soil. The release of these unsafe materials can pollute groundwater, pollute the air, and add to dirt destruction, positioning serious health and wellness threats to nearby areas and environments.
In addition, the incorrect disposal of e-waste additionally contributes to the exhaustion of natural deposits. computer recycling. Lots of digital tools contain important steels like gold, silver, and copper that can be recouped and recycled if correctly reused. Nevertheless, when e-waste is not recycled, these important sources are shed, and the need for brand-new basic materials rises, causing boosted mining activities and further environmental deterioration.
To mitigate the environmental effect of e-waste, appropriate recycling and disposal approaches have to be used. This includes the liable collection, taking down, and recycling of electronic tools to recover valuable products and ensure the secure monitoring of unsafe materials. Executing efficient e-waste management practices is essential to protect the setting, save resources, and promote a sustainable future.
Benefits of Accountable Computer Recycling
Correctly recycling computer systems uses a wide variety of advantages, including ecological preservation and source preservation. Accountable computer system reusing not just helps prevent digital waste from winding up in garbage dumps, however it also lowers the demand for resources and power in the manufacturing of new devices.
Among the most significant benefits of accountable computer system recycling is the conservation of the environment. When electronic waste is incorrectly gotten rid of, it can launch harmful substances such as lead, mercury, and cadmium right into the soil and water, posing a hazard to communities and human health. By reusing computer systems, these hazardous products can be securely extracted and taken care of, minimizing the threat of air pollution.
Another benefit is source preservation. Computers consist of beneficial materials like gold, silver, aluminum, and copper, which can be recuperated and recycled via recycling processes. By drawing out and recycling these products, the need for mining new sources is decreased, preserving all-natural resources and decreasing the ecological effect of source removal.
Moreover, liable computer system reusing assists to lower power consumption. Manufacturing new computer systems calls for a substantial amount of energy, from the extraction of resources to the setting up process. By reusing computer systems and recycling their components, the energy-intensive manufacturing procedure can be stayed clear of, bring about a decrease in greenhouse gas discharges and an extra sustainable use power sources.
Just How to Pick a Trustworthy Computer Recycling Solution
When picking a computer system reusing solution, it is important to consider a few vital variables to ensure that you choose a trustworthy and trustworthy supplier. It is crucial to verify if the reusing solution adheres to correct environmental policies and methods. A trustworthy provider will have qualifications and accreditations that demonstrate their dedication to accountable recycling. Seek qualifications such as R2 (Accountable Recycling) or e-Stewards, which make certain that the recycling procedure satisfies strict requirements for environmental management and data security. The Recycling Refine for Computers and Digital Instruments
To ensure responsible disposal and decrease ecological impact, understanding the reusing process for computers and digital devices is important when selecting a reliable recycling service. The recycling process for these gadgets generally includes numerous phases.
Firstly, the gadgets are gathered from individuals, organizations, or drop-off points. This collection procedure might involve transport logistics and secure taking care of to shield the sensitive information contained within useful link the devices. Once accumulated, the tools are sorted based on their type, such as mobile phones, laptop computers, or desktops.
After arranging, the tools undergo a complete information destruction process to make sure that any type of sensitive or individual information is completely erased. This step is important to safeguard the personal privacy and security of companies and individuals. Information damage methods may include wiping, degaussing, or physical devastation of the storage media.
Next, the gadgets are taken apart right into their individual elements. This permits the splitting up of various products, such as plastics, metals, and circuit boards. These materials are after that sent out to specialized reusing centers for more processing.
The recycling facilities use various methods to remove beneficial products from the digital waste. These products can be recycled or repurposed in the production of brand-new products. The continuing to be waste is thrown away in an eco liable fashion, adhering to regulatory guidelines.
The Duty of Federal Government Rules in E-Waste Administration
Government policies play a crucial role in the effective management of e-waste. With the constant growth of the electronics market and the boosting worry for environmental sustainability, the requirement for correct disposal and recycling of electronic waste has actually come to be a lot more noticeable. Federal government guidelines help to guarantee that e-waste is handled in a responsible and lasting manner.
Among the main duties of federal government regulations is to set standards and standards for e-waste monitoring. These guidelines specify the correct approaches for collection, transport, and recycling of digital waste. By developing these requirements, governments can make certain that e-waste is taken care of in a means that minimizes its impact on the environment and human health.
This includes applying take-back programs, where producers are liable for collecting and reusing digital waste from consumers. These guidelines aid to shift the problem of e-waste management from the private consumer to the market, making certain that electronic waste is handled in a much more sustainable way.
